In a sneak peek of Thursday’s Keeping Up with the Kardashians episode, Kim Kardashian admitted to sisters Kourtney and Khloé that she failed her first year law student exam!

Related: Kim Claims She’s ‘Not Responsible’ For Domestic Staff Lawsuit!

In a confessional, the SKIMS founder explained that because she’s in a four-year law program, she was required to take a “baby bar” exam, unlike what traditional three-year program students are forced to endure. While it’s not the official test, some warned it would be “harder,” which evidently it was! She shared:

“If you are doing law school the way I’m doing it, it is a four-year program instead of your typical three-year program. And after year one, you have to take the baby bar. This one actually is harder, I hear, than the official bar.”

In an emotional clip with her mentor, Jessica Jackson, the momma of four chatted about the failed test, but was left with some encouragement by the attorney. As it turns out, Kim wasn’t actually that far from a pass, receiving a score of 474 instead of 560!
